    I have a charged-off credit card with Capital One and I wonder something. Would they or any other bank, instead of making me pay it off right then and there, extend me another line of credit in the form of a card and be willing to transfer the charged-off balance to it? It would still be a win-win situation. I could have the option of minimum monthly payment due, but they could still be making interest off me. Is this a viable option for any credit card company including Capital One? Thoughts are appreciated...thanks!

    I had two charged off with Capital One (they were secured). Five years later they were calling me asking me to sign up for one of their cards. Low low credit line (200). They did not even bring up the past cards. I checked and they are still being reported as charged off but are going to fall off in less than a year. The unsecured card I have gotten from them has been great. No problems of any kind.
